If you own rental properties, then you know how important it is to keep tenants that pay on time and have proven to be reliable and problem-free happy. The less times you are faced with evictions, the better for your bottom line, as well as peace of mind. That is why it is good to use a rental management firm to make sure that your properties stay well maintained and that the occupants are tenants who will become long-term residents.

Good Tenants – Assessing their ProfileSo, how do you attract residents that will stay for long periods in your properties? Tenants who rent long-term are dependable, usually have a good credit history, have no problems associated with their rental history, and also have a clear criminal background check. Therefore, when you use the services of a rental management company, it is important to focus on screening as well as maintenance.

A Provider in Oklahoma CityIn Oklahoma City, a rental management company should feature a full array of services. Make sure the management company offers tenant screening, move-out assistance, financial recordkeeping, property marketing, legal updates, safety recommendations, property inspections, eviction processing and repair and maintenance services. It should be able to provide assistance in one of several key areas regardless of the number of homes or buildings you currently rent.
